Underwater Photo Location: Shark Point, Sydney

Underwater Photo Location: Shark Point, Sydney

How Hot is this Dive Site? click a star to rate it
Great shore dive, has a depth of around 25 mtr, hard to access when seas are up or if there is a southerly blowing.
Facts about Shark Point, Sydney
  • It is in Australia
  • Shark Point, Sydney is in the Tasman Sea.
  • The typical depth is 0-30 Metres 0-100 Feet.
  • The typical visibility is 10-30 Metres 30-100 Feet.
